Subject: DR drill — Matchbox GC pause simulation

Plugin authors: Friday we run a disaster-recovery drill on the Matchbox matching service. We will inject artificial garbage-collection pauses up to 8 seconds to verify plugins handle stalled callbacks. Expect timeouts in the sandbox tier only. Plugins must retry idempotently; anything that double-matches fails certification. Results posted Monday. To pull the drill harness from the sealed staging vault, authenticate with the passphrase below.

unlock words, yawig-kagef: gordor-holvan-ulaael-pramir-ulaiel-tamdor

Release managers should note that the sweeper's account is scoped to delete-only permissions and cannot restore data; any rollback requires the Cobaltine admin path. Before promoting a new sweeper build, verify it can authenticate against the retention-policy service in staging. The staging credential is rotated quarterly and must not be reused in production. The current staging API key follows.

app token of bahaf-tajeg = zpat23_SjjsllwiLmXbtS65veZaV47

## Runbook: StockTally Reconciliation Job

Runs nightly at 02:15. Compares warehouse counts against the Ferndale ledger. If the job stalls past 30 minutes, kill it and rerun with the --resume flag. Do not rerun twice in one night; it double-counts transfers. Alerts page the inventory channel. Escalate to the data team only if variance exceeds 2%. Before any manual rerun, verify the job is using the current configuration, shown below.

config for kafof-bawef:
holath:
  log_level: debug
  metrics_host: metrics.holath.qorvelsys.internal
  pin: 2191
  pool_size: 32

## Authentication

Tabulance sorts report rows with a stable merge sort, so equal keys keep input order — reviewers, please verify tests assert on that. All report-builder calls authenticate against the internal Tabulance gateway; no anonymous access. For local review runs, use the service key that appears immediately below.

API key for yahig-tadup: kto7_ubizbYm

Facilities Ticket — Cleaning Crew Access, Brindle Annex

For new starters handling evening lock-up: the Sorano Cleaning crew arrives nightly at 21:30 via the annex side door. Check their rota sheet, note arrival in the log, and ensure the storeroom is relocked afterward. To let them through the side door, enter the access code below.

badge for yaweg-hafog: bdg-GX-6